Observant Muslims around the globe eagerly await the arrival of Ramadan each year. This holy month of fasting, prayer, and reflection is a time for spiritual growth and renewal. In 2024, Ramadan is anticipated to begin on March 10th, marking the first day of celebration. The exact dates may slightly based on lunar sighting and regional customs.
During Ramadan, Muslims abstain from food and drink from break of day until sunset. This period of fasting is intended to foster self-discipline, empathy for the less fortunate, and a deeper connection with Allah. As the month progresses, Muslims engage in various rituals, including nightly prayers (Taraweeh) and chant the Quran.

Ramadan Observances: A Comprehensive Guide
Throughout the Islamic calendar, Ramadan stands as a respected month of worship. During this time, Muslims observe a journey of emotional strengthening. To fulfill the tenets of Ramadan, there are certain observances that shape daily life.
- Firstly, abstaining from food and drink from dawn till dusk is a key observance known as Sawm. This practice encourages self-discipline, compassion for those in need, and a deeper connection with Allah
- Additionally, Muslims dedicate themselves to heightened prayer throughout Ramadan. The nightly prayer known as Qiyaam is particularly significant, granting an opportunity for contemplation.
- Lastly, the month culminates in a joyous celebration called Eid al-Fitr, marking the end of Ramadan and a time for festive gatherings with loved ones.
